ERP(企业资源计划)项目实施流程是企业在信息化建设过程中不可或缺的重要环节。随着现代企业管理的不断升级,ERP系统已经成为提升企业运营效率、优化资源配置和增强市场竞争力的核心工具。然而,ERP项目的成功并非一蹴而就,其实施过程涉及多个阶段,需要周密的规划、严格的执行以及持续的优化。
ERP项目实施流程通常包括需求分析、系统选型、方案设计、系统开发、测试上线、培训推广以及后期运维等多个阶段。每个阶段都对项目的成败起着至关重要的作用,因此,企业必须在实施过程中保持高度的重视,并结合自身特点制定合理的策略。
1. 需求分析:明确目标,奠定基础
需求分析是ERP项目实施的第一步,也是最为关键的一环。在此阶段,企业需要全面梳理自身的业务流程,识别当前存在的问题和瓶颈,同时明确希望通过ERP系统实现的目标。这一步不仅关系到后续系统的功能配置,还直接影响到项目的投资回报率。
需求分析通常包括以下几个方面:
- 业务流程调研:通过访谈、问卷调查等方式,了解企业各部门的工作流程,识别哪些环节可以借助ERP系统进行优化。
- 功能需求收集:根据调研结果,列出ERP系统需要具备的功能模块,如财务、采购、销售、库存管理等。
- 组织架构与权限设置:确定不同部门和岗位在ERP系统中的角色和权限,确保数据的安全性和操作的合规性。
- 数据迁移规划:考虑现有系统中数据的整理、清洗和迁移方式,确保数据的完整性和一致性。
需要注意的是,需求分析不能仅停留在表面,而是要深入挖掘企业的实际痛点,避免因需求不清晰导致后续实施过程中频繁变更,增加成本和风险。
2. 系统选型:选择适合企业的解决方案
在完成需求分析后,企业需要根据自身的需求选择合适的ERP系统。目前市场上常见的ERP产品有SAP、Oracle、用友、金蝶、浪潮等。每种系统都有其特点和适用范围,企业应结合自身规模、行业属性、预算以及未来发展等因素进行综合评估。
系统选型的关键在于以下几个方面:
- 功能匹配度:所选系统是否能够满足企业的核心业务需求,是否具备良好的扩展性。
- 技术兼容性:ERP系统是否能够与企业现有的IT基础设施、数据库和其他管理系统无缝对接。
- 供应商实力:选择有良好口碑和技术支持能力的供应商,确保项目在实施过程中得到充分的技术保障。
- 成本效益:不仅要考虑软件购买和实施费用,还要综合评估长期维护、升级和培训的成本。
此外,企业还可以考虑采用云ERP或混合部署模式,以降低初期投入,提高灵活性和可扩展性。
3. 方案设计:构建符合企业特色的实施方案
方案设计是将需求转化为具体实施步骤的关键环节。在这一阶段,企业需要与ERP供应商合作,制定详细的实施方案,涵盖系统配置、流程再造、数据迁移、用户培训等内容。
方案设计主要包括以下几个部分:
- 业务流程重构:根据ERP系统的特性,对企业原有的业务流程进行优化和重组,提高效率。
- 系统架构设计:确定ERP系统的整体架构,包括硬件环境、网络配置、数据库设计等。
- 数据模型设计:根据业务需求,设计合理的数据结构和存储方式,确保数据的准确性和完整性。
- 用户界面设计:根据用户习惯和操作需求,设计直观易用的系统界面,提高用户体验。
在方案设计过程中,企业需要充分考虑实际情况,避免照搬标准方案,确保设计方案真正适用于自身的业务场景。
4. 系统开发:定制化配置与集成
系统开发是ERP项目实施的核心环节,主要涉及系统的定制化配置和与其他系统的集成。对于标准化的ERP系统,企业可能只需要进行基本的配置即可;而对于需要深度定制的企业,则可能需要进行二次开发,以满足特定的业务需求。
系统开发的主要任务包括:
- 模块配置:根据需求分析的结果,对ERP系统的各个模块进行配置,如财务模块、采购模块、销售模块等。
- 接口开发:如果企业已有其他管理系统,如CRM、OA、MES等,需要开发相应的接口,实现数据互通。
- 报表与数据分析:根据企业的管理需求,开发定制化的报表和数据分析功能,提升决策效率。
- 安全机制设计:确保系统在运行过程中具备完善的安全机制,防止数据泄露和非法访问。
在系统开发过程中,企业需要与ERP供应商密切配合,确保开发进度和质量。同时,还需注意开发的合理性,避免过度定制,影响系统的稳定性和后续维护。
5. 测试上线:确保系统稳定运行
测试上线是ERP项目实施过程中最关键的一环,直接关系到系统的稳定性和用户的满意度。在这一阶段,企业需要进行全面的测试,包括功能测试、性能测试、压力测试和安全测试等。
测试的主要内容包括:
- 功能测试:验证ERP系统是否按照需求文档实现了所有功能。
- 性能测试:检查系统在高并发、大数据量情况下的运行表现。
- 压力测试:模拟极端条件下的系统运行状态,确保系统具备足够的稳定性。
- 安全测试:检测系统是否存在安全漏洞,防止数据被非法篡改或窃取。
测试完成后,企业需要制定详细的上线计划,包括数据迁移、系统切换、用户培训等内容。在正式上线前,还需要进行一次全面的“沙盘演练”,确保各环节衔接顺畅。
6. 培训推广:提高用户适应能力
ERP系统的成功实施离不开用户的积极参与和熟练操作。因此,在系统上线后,企业需要开展系统的培训和推广工作,帮助员工快速掌握系统的使用方法。
培训的内容通常包括:
- 系统操作培训:讲解ERP系统的各项功能,指导用户如何登录、录入数据、生成报表等。
- 业务流程培训:介绍ERP系统如何支持和优化原有业务流程,提高工作效率。
- 异常处理培训:教授用户如何应对系统故障、数据错误等问题,减少操作失误。
- 管理层培训:针对高层管理人员,提供关于系统数据分析和决策支持的培训,提升管理效能。
除了集中培训外,企业还可以通过制作操作手册、视频教程、在线答疑等方式,帮助员工随时随地学习和查阅相关信息。
7. 后期运维:持续优化与升级
ERP系统的实施并不是一次性的工作,而是需要长期的运维和优化。在系统上线后,企业需要建立完善的运维机制,确保系统的正常运行,并根据业务发展不断进行调整和升级。
后期运维的主要任务包括:
- 日常维护:监控系统运行状态,及时处理故障,保证系统的稳定性和可用性。
- 数据备份与恢复:定期备份重要数据,防止因意外情况导致数据丢失。
- 用户反馈与改进:收集用户在使用过程中遇到的问题和建议,不断优化系统功能。
- 版本升级与功能拓展:根据业务需求和技术发展,适时进行系统升级和功能拓展。
此外,企业还需要建立一支专业的IT团队,负责ERP系统的日常管理和技术支持,确保系统始终处于最佳运行状态。
8. 成功案例分享:借鉴经验,少走弯路
为了更好地理解ERP项目实施流程,我们可以参考一些成功的案例,从中吸取经验和教训。
例如,某大型制造企业在实施ERP项目时,首先进行了全面的需求调研,明确了系统需要覆盖的业务流程和功能模块。随后,他们选择了适合自身规模的ERP系统,并与供应商密切合作,制定了详细的实施方案。在系统开发过程中,他们注重模块配置和接口开发,确保系统能够与现有系统无缝对接。测试阶段,他们进行了多轮测试,确保系统的稳定性和安全性。上线后,企业开展了广泛的培训,提高了员工的操作技能。最终,该企业成功实现了ERP系统的全面上线,并显著提升了运营效率。
另一个案例是一家中小型零售企业在实施ERP项目时,由于预算有限,选择了云ERP方案,降低了初期投入,同时通过灵活的部署方式实现了快速上线。他们在系统上线后,重点关注了数据迁移和用户培训,确保系统能够顺利运行。
这些成功案例表明,ERP项目的实施并不局限于大企业,任何企业都可以根据自身情况选择合适的方案,并按照科学的流程推进项目。
9. 常见问题与解决办法
在ERP项目实施过程中,企业可能会遇到各种问题,以下是一些常见问题及其解决办法:
问题一:需求不明确,导致系统功能与实际不符
解决办法:在需求分析阶段,企业应深入调研,明确核心业务需求,并邀请相关部门参与讨论,确保需求的全面性和准确性。
问题二:系统选型不当,导致后期难以维护
解决办法:企业在选型时应综合考虑系统功能、技术兼容性、供应商实力以及成本效益,选择最适合自身发展的方案。
问题三:用户抵触情绪严重,系统使用率低
解决办法:加强用户培训,提高员工对系统的认知和接受度。同时,可以通过激励措施,鼓励员工积极使用系统。
问题四:系统上线后出现大量数据问题
解决办法:在数据迁移阶段,应做好数据清洗和整理,确保数据的准确性和完整性。同时,上线前应进行数据验证,发现问题及时修正。
问题五:系统运行不稳定,影响业务
解决办法:建立完善的运维机制,定期检查系统运行状态,及时处理问题。同时,选择可靠的供应商,确保系统有足够的技术支持。
10. 总结:ERP项目实施流程的要点与建议
ERP项目实施流程是一个复杂且系统性的工程,涉及多个阶段和环节。为了确保项目的成功,企业需要在每一个阶段都做到科学规划、精细执行,并持续优化。
首先,企业应高度重视需求分析,确保系统能够真正满足业务需求。其次,在系统选型和方案设计过程中,应结合自身特点,选择最适合的解决方案。第三,在系统开发和测试阶段,要注重细节,确保系统的稳定性和安全性。第四,在系统上线后,必须做好用户培训和推广,提高员工的适应能力。最后,系统上线后仍需持续运维和优化,以确保系统的长期稳定运行。
总之,ERP项目的成功实施不是一蹴而就的,它需要企业具备清晰的战略思维、严谨的执行力和持续的创新精神。只有这样,才能充分发挥ERP系统的价值,推动企业向更高层次的发展迈进。